Ordinals
beta
Sat 699770096848781
decimal
139954.96848781
degree
0°139954′850″96848781‴
percentile
17.758912956296964%
name
vxvdxhcffbw
cycle
0
epoch
0
period
69
block
139954
offset
96848781
timestamp
2011-08-07 09:28:11 UTC
rarity
common
prev
next